About Husvar
The surname Husvar is of Hungarian origin and is derived from the word "huszár," which means "hussar" in English. Hussars were light cavalry soldiers in the Hungarian military during the medieval and early modern periods. Therefore, the surname Husvar likely originated as a occupational name for someone who was a hussar or had some association with the hussar cavalry.
